    In a deck of cards, the ace is a unique and often highly valued card. It typically represents the highest or lowest value in a suit, depending on the game being played. The ace is distinguished by its design, which, as you mentioned, usually features a single pip or symbol. This design element is a key part of what makes an ace stand out among the other cards in the deck.

    The standard French deck, which is widely used around the world, includes four suits: hearts, diamonds, spades, and clubs. Each suit contains an ace, and these aces are marked with a single suit symbol. The design of the ace can vary, but it is often large and prominently displayed in the center of the card. This central placement makes it easy to identify, even at a glance.

    The ace of spades, in particular, often receives special attention in terms of design. It may be more ornate or decorated than other aces, reflecting its status as a significant card. The spade is the only suit that is a blade, which could symbolize strength or power, and this is often reflected in the design of the ace of spades.

    In many card games, the ace can act as a high card, taking the value of 11 or 1, depending on the context. This flexibility makes the ace a versatile and strategic card to have in your hand. In some games, such as blackjack, the ace is particularly important because it can help achieve the goal of getting a hand value as close to 21 as possible without going over.

    An ace is a playing card, die or domino with a single pip. In the standard French deck, an ace has a single suit symbol (a heart, diamond, spade, or club) located in the middle of the card, sometimes large and decorated, especially in the case of the ace of spades.read more >>
